.cpilot-tee-decision-block{margin-top:1.2rem}.cpilot-tee-decision-block__top-actions{margin-bottom:.45rem}.cpilot-tee-decision-block__top-link{display:inline-flex;align-items:center;gap:.4rem;font-weight:700}.cpilot-tee-decision-block__model-reference{display:grid;gap:.25rem;margin:.25rem 0 .2rem;padding:.75rem 0;border-top:1px solid rgb(var(--text-color) / .08);border-bottom:1px solid rgb(var(--text-color) / .08)}.cpilot-tee-decision-block__model-label{color:rgb(var(--heading-color) / .74);font-size:.78r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ase}.cpilot-tee-decision-block__model-value{color:rgb(var(--text-color));font-size:.92rem;line-height:1.5}.cpilot-tee-decision-block__disclosure{margin-bottom:0}.cpilot-tee-decision-block__toggle{padding:1rem 2rem 1rem 0}.cpilot-tee-decision-block__toggle-copy{display:grid;gap:.25rem}.cpilot-tee-decision-block__eyebrow{margin:0;color:rgb(var(--heading-color) / .62);font-size:.75rem;font-weight:700;letter-spacing:.16em;text-transform:uppercase}.cpilot-tee-decision-block__toggle-title-row{display:grid;gap:.3rem}.cpilot-tee-decision-block__title{margin:0}.cpilot-tee-decision-block__toggle-preview{color:rgb(var(--text-color) / .76);line-height:1.5}.cpilot-tee-decision-block__content{padding-bottom:1.2rem}.cpilot-tee-decision-block__summary{display:grid;gap:0;margin-top:.3rem;border-top:1px solid rgb(var(--text-color) / .08)}.cpilot-tee-decision-block__summary-item{display:grid;gap:.2rem;padding:.8rem 0;border-bottom:1px solid rgb(var(--text-color) / .08)}.cpilot-tee-decision-block__summary-label{color:rgb(var(--heading-color) / .74);font-size:.78r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ase}.cpilot-tee-decision-block__summary-value{color:rgb(var(--text-color));font-size:.92rem;line-height:1.5;margin:0}.cpilot-family-navigation{margin:.85rem 0 1.15rem;--cpilot-family-navigation-tooltip-z: 2}.cpilot-family-navigation__header{display:flex;gap:.75rem;align-items:baseline;justify-content:space-between;margin-bottom:.6rem}.cpilot-family-navigation__label{color:rgb(var(--text-color) / .7);font-size:.82rem;font-weight:600;letter-spacing:0;text-transform:none}.cpilot-family-navigation__current{color:rgb(var(--heading-color));font-weight:700}.cpilot-family-navigation__count{color:rgb(var(--text-color) / .58);font-size:.78rem}.cpilot-family-navigation__state{display:flex;flex-wrap:wrap;gap:.55rem .8rem;align-items:center;margin:-.2rem 0 .65rem;color:rgb(var(--text-color) / .72);font-size:.82rem;line-height:1.4}.cpilot-family-navigation__status{display:inline-block}.cpilot-family-navigation__clear{padding:0;border:0;background:transparent;color:rgb(var(--heading-color));cursor:pointer;font:inherit;font-weight:700;text-decoration:underline;text-underline-offset:.18em}.cpilot-family-navigation__clear:focus-visible{outline:2px solid rgb(var(--heading-color));outline-offset:.18rem}.cpilot-family-navigation__gr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(2.65rem,1fr));gap:.38rem;max-width:24rem}.cpilot-family-navigation__item{display:flex;position:relative;flex-direction:column;min-height:2.75rem;border:1px solid rgb(var(--text-color) / .12);border-radius:.28rem;background:#fff;color:rgb(var(--text-color));overflow:visible;transition:border-color .2s ease,box-shadow .2s ease,transform .2s ease}.cpilot-family-navigation__item:hover:not(.is-unavailable){border-color:rgb(var(--heading-color) / .45);transform:translateY(-1px)}.cpilot-family-navigation__item:focus-visible{outline:2px solid rgb(var(--heading-color));outline-offset:.18rem}.cpilot-family-navigation__item.is-active{border-color:rgb(var(--heading-color));box-shadow:inset 0 0 0 1px rgb(var(--heading-color))}.cpilot-family-navigation__item.is-unavailable{cursor:not-allowed;opacity:.48}.cpilot-family-navigation__item.is-unavailable:after{content:"";position:absolute;z-index:1;top:50%;left:12%;width:76%;border-top:1px solid rgb(var(--heading-color) / .68);transform:rotate(-38deg);transform-origin:center}.cpilot-family-navigation__item[aria-disabled=true]:focus-visible{outline-style:dashed}.cpilot-family-navigation-is-loading .cpilot-family-navigation__item{pointer-events:none}.cpilot-family-navigation-is-loading .cpilot-family-navigation{opacity:.72}.cpilot-family-navigation__image{display:block;order:1;width:100%;aspect-ratio:1;border-radius:.2rem;object-fit:contain;overflow:hidden;padding:0}.cpilot-family-navigation__image--placeholder{display:grid;place-items:center;min-height:3.35rem;font-weight:700;text-transform:uppercase}.cpilot-family-navigation__colour-label{position:absolute;z-index:var(--cpilot-family-navigation-tooltip-z);left:50%;bottom:calc(100% + .35rem);max-width:min(10rem,45vw);padding:.26rem .42rem;border:1px solid rgb(var(--heading-color) / .08);border-radius:999px;background:rgb(var(--body-bg-color));box-shadow:0 .45rem 1.2rem rgb(var(--heading-color) / .14);color:rgb(var(--heading-color));font-size:.68rem;font-weight:700;line-height:1.2;opacity:0;pointer-events:none;text-align:center;transform:translate(-50%,.18rem);transition:opacity .16s ease,transform .16s ease,visibility .16s ease;visibility:hidden;white-space:nowrap}.cpilot-family-navigation__colour-label:after{content:"";position:absolute;left:50%;bottom:-.28rem;width:.55rem;height:.55rem;border-right:1px solid rgb(var(--heading-color) / .08);border-bottom:1px solid rgb(var(--heading-color) / .08);background:rgb(var(--body-bg-color));transform:translate(-50%) rotate(45deg)}.cpilot-family-navigation__item:hover .cpilot-family-navigation__colour-label,.cpilot-family-navigation__item:focus-visible .cpilot-family-navigation__colour-label{opacity:1;transform:translate(-50%);visibility:visible}@media(max-width:749px){.cpilot-family-navigation__grid{grid-template-columns:repeat(auto-fill,minmax(3.1rem,1fr));max-width:100%}.cpilot-family-navigation__count{display:none}}@media(hover:none)and (pointer:coarse){.cpilot-family-navigation__item{min-height:4.1rem}.cpilot-family-navigation__colour-label{position:static;order:2;max-width:none;margin:-.1rem .12rem .3rem;padding:0;border:0;background:transparent;box-shadow:none;color:rgb(var(--text-color) / .72);font-size:.58rem;font-weight:600;opacity:1;overflow-wrap:anywhere;text-transform:none;transform:none;visibility:visible;white-space:normal}.cpilot-family-navigation__colour-label:after{content:none}}@media(prefers-reduced-motion:reduce){.cpilot-family-navigation__item{transition:none}.cpilot-family-navigation__item:hover:not(.is-unavailable){transform:none}}.cpilot-size-guide-modal__window{width:min(58rem,calc(100vw - 2rem))}.modal:has(.cpilot-size-guide-modal__window){--cpilot-overlay-z: 10000;--cpilot-size-guide-safe-top: calc(var(--theme-sticky-header-height, 0px) + 1rem);--cpilot-size-guide-safe-bottom: max(4.5rem, env(safe-area-inset-bottom));align-items:flex-start;bottom:0;box-sizing:border-box;height:100%;justify-content:center;overflow-y:auto;padding:var(--cpilot-size-guide-safe-top) 1rem var(--cpilot-size-guide-safe-bottom);top:0;z-index:var(--cpilot-overlay-z)}.modal:has(.cpilot-size-guide-modal__window) .cpilot-size-guide-modal__window{display:flex;flex-direction:column;margin:0 auto;max-height:calc(100dvh - var(--cpilot-size-guide-safe-top) - var(--cpilot-size-guide-safe-bottom));overflow:hidden}.modal:has(.cpilot-size-guide-modal__window) [data-cpilot-area=size-chart-modal]{flex:1 1 auto;min-height:0;overflow-y:auto;padding-bottom:1.25rem}@media(max-width:749px){.modal:has(.cpilot-size-guide-modal__window){--cpilot-size-guide-safe-top: max(1rem, env(safe-area-inset-top));--cpilot-size-guide-safe-bottom: max(1rem, env(safe-area-inset-bottom))}}.cpilot-size-guide-modal__title{margin:0;padding-inline-end:2.75rem}.cpilot-size-guide-modal__lede{margin:.85rem 0 0;color:rgb(var(--text-color) / .82);line-height:1.6}.cpilot-size-guide-modal__facts{display:grid;gap:.75rem;margin-top:1.5rem}.cpilot-size-guide-modal__fact{padding:.9rem 1rem;border:1px solid rgb(var(--text-color) / .08);border-radius:1rem;background:rgb(var(--text-color) / .03)}.cpilot-size-guide-modal__fact-label{display:block;margin-bottom:.2rem;color:rgb(var(--heading-color) / .7);font-size:.76r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ase}.cpilot-size-guide-modal__fact-value{color:rgb(var(--text-color));line-height:1.5}.cpilot-size-guide-modal__table-section{margin-top:1.75rem}.cpilot-size-guide-modal__table-heading{display:flex;flex-wrap:wrap;gap:.75rem;align-items:center;justify-content:space-between;margin-bottom:.85rem}.cpilot-size-guide-modal__table-title{margin:0}.cpilot-size-guide-modal__selected-note{margin:0;color:rgb(var(--text-color) / .78);font-weight:600}.cpilot-size-guide-modal__table-row{transition:background-color .2s ease,color .2s ease}.cpilot-size-guide-modal__table-row:hover{--table-row-bg: rgb(var(--text-color) / .04)}.cpilot-size-guide-modal__table-row.is-selected{--table-row-bg: rgb(var(--heading-color) / .12)}.cpilot-size-guide-modal__table-row.is-selected :is(th,td){color:rgb(var(--heading-color));font-weight:700}.cpilot-size-guide-modal__support{display:grid;gap:1rem;margin-top:1.5rem}.cpilot-size-guide-modal__image-card,.cpilot-size-guide-modal__note-card{padding:1rem;border:1px solid rgb(var(--text-color) / .08);border-radius:1rem;background:rgb(var(--text-color) / .02)}.cpilot-size-guide-modal__image-title,.cpilot-size-guide-modal__note-title{margin:0 0 .75rem}.cpilot-size-guide-modal__image{display:block;width:100%;height:auto}.cpilot-size-guide-modal__note-copy:last-child{margin-bottom:0}@media(min-width:768px){.cpilot-tee-decision-block__toggle-title-row{grid-template-columns:minmax(0,auto) minmax(0,1fr);gap:.75rem;align-items:baseline}.cpilot-size-guide-modal__facts{grid-template-columns:repeat(2,minmax(0,1fr))}.cpilot-size-guide-modal__support{grid-template-columns:minmax(0,1.55fr) minmax(0,1fr);align-items:start}}
/*# sourceMappingURL=/cdn/shop/t/17/assets/cpilot-tee-decision-block.css.map */
